Almost all of us experience some degree of anxiety every now and after that. It's normal to experience stress in such situations. Then there are people who experience anxiety on a frequent basis, and feel restless when there are no immediate threats present. Treatment is required by this type of anxiety.
Before we get into some of the treatment options, it is important to understand what anxiety is, and how it occurs.
Stress occurs when our body reacts to an imaginary danger like it were real. Our breathing and heart rate changes, adrenaline starts flowing, and as we go into the battle or flight response we sweat.
NOTE: Never assume chest pains are okay unless under the direct guidance of a physician. The symptoms of a heart attack should not be disregarded, even if you have anxiety.
Among the difficulties of diagnosing stress is that a lot of the symptoms can be related to other conditions. Ergo, the sufferer may assume they have another medical problem, when in reality they actually have an anxiety disorder. Symptoms can include, but aren't restricted to: shortness of breath, nausea, strong pulse, ...
... chest pain, exhaustion, headaches, tummy pains, and sleeplessness. That is quite a list, isn't it? Someone with a powerful heartbeat and pain in their own chest would be completely justified in thinking they were having a heart attack, but it could only be a panic attack.
You ought to seek treatment if it's causing a negative effect in your life, while you might have the ability to live with all the occasional bout of anxiety. An adverse impact is something that takes away from your personal quality of life, and your enjoyment of it. Not going to social events, remaining in due to a panic of the external planet, never stepping out of your "safe zone" because you are afraid you won't be able to survive are some common examples.
